LAWRENCE, Mass. — The new mayor of Lawrence will give his inaugural address Monday in English and Spanish. The majority Hispanic city made history this fall when it elected the state’s first Latino mayor, but Dominican-born William Lantigua is also controversial. Many residents say they are willing to overlook Lantigua’s idiosyncrasies, hoping he can fix this troubled city.

For the last six years, Willy Lantigua has served as a state representative from Lawrence, one of the state’s poorest cities. He took the unusual step of opening an office away from the State House, in downtown Lawrence.

He and his staff helped people there with constituent services, and he was surprised to find that most of their problems were local.

“[They had] problems that have to do with the office of the mayor and the city council, but yet they come to me,” Lantigua says. “So, if 90 percent of the issues that I deal with have to do with city hall, and I have to call so many people who sometimes don’t even answer, why not be the mayor? Why not be the boss and make those issues go away?”
